Output 61ebaa165cf6c7f252e8925226b51f9756dceb08f578cf6ef23e1fbc74cb135e:0

value
38237993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70fa28bf7b8281eeb5e7398d39d7c1323d2c56a3 OP_EQUAL
address
MJCXbH9NSzWUdty4VqUtkXUtgCMUzii8vq
transaction
61ebaa165cf6c7f252e8925226b51f9756dceb08f578cf6ef23e1fbc74cb135e
spent
true